(Stourton
Press) Hall (Fairfax). Bitter
Memory.Square 12mo, pp.19[1], colophon, Dacre Street, Westminster, August
1934.
One of 50 copies set in Eric Gill’s 10-point ‘Aries’ type, printed on
specially watermarked hand-made paper, not for sale. Quarter linen with gilt
spine lettering, Cockerell marbled paper-covered sides, predominantly buff,
grey and black. Endpapers a little yellowed. A near fine copy
Rare. A verse-tale in which the story turns upon a record of Schumann’s
‘Romance in A’.
